What is the Triangle Inequality Theorem?

The triangle inequality theorem states that for any triangle, the sum of the lengths of any two sides must be greater than the length of the remaining side. This rule ensures that the three sides can actually form a triangle and is foundational in geometry.

Theoretical Context and Educational Significance

At its core, the triangle inequality theorem provides a necessary condition for the existence of a triangle, establishing that the sum of any two sides must exceed the third side. This theorem not only supports foundational geometric reasoning but also serves as a gateway to higher-level mathematical understanding, including metric spaces and vector analysis.
